Two levels of importance over the medium term can be seen on the chart i've posted.

I think level 1 will most likely provide the best support as it was resistance before breaking out for the massive run over the last 2/3 months.

CML is such a strong stock that it could reverse @ any point in time. The market has left a gap @ R61.69 which will most likely be filled in time. I'll be watching for a bigger sell off and move down back to R50.00, that would definitely be an appealing level for the long term if you've been wanting to invest in coronation.

PNC

 

The Board of Directors of Pinnacle is pleased to announce that it has entered into an agreement with Co-ordinated
Network Investments Proprietary Limited and Hoolican Investments Proprietary Limited (collectively the ?Sellers?) in
terms of which Pinnacle (or a nominated wholly owned subsidiary of Pinnacle), will acquire in one indivisible transaction,
61,152,467 ordinary shares (?Acquired Shares?) in Datacentrix Holdings Limited (?Datacentrix?) in an off-market sale
and purchase (the ?Acquisition?). The Acquired shares represent approximately 29.79% of the issued ordinary share
capital of Datacentrix.
